Our Work In Wichita

Open Airways for Schools (OAS)

OAS is a school based asthma education curriculum designed for youth aged 8-11 with a diagnosis of asthma. This research based “best practice” program is highly interactive to teach children how to manage and control their disease. Last year, 92 students in Sedgwick County learned how to better manage and control their asthma by participating in this program.

Living with Asthma

This is a two hour evening learning opportunity that allows patients and caregivers an in-depth review of asthma management. Programs for children and adults are offered concurrently. The children’s program utilizes interactive games to teach core health messages. Last year we offered five programs, reaching 30 adults and 20 children.

Open Airways for Schools in the Community

This is an asthma education research project for those with uncontrolled asthma. This project is designed to show that asthma education will reduce the costs of medical care for patients with asthma, especially those that are not well managed. We utilize the Open Airways for Schools program to teach asthma management skills throughout the community, in order to reduce asthma related hospitalizations and emergency room visits.
